Despite initial teething troubles, due largely to inadequate enforcement experience, the Police assessment is that it has been generally adequate and is an effective deterrent to illegal operators and gamblers. Compared with the other measures introduced since 1973, the Police view is that Gambling Ordinance 1977 is probably the most effective weapon in reducing the overall level of illegal gambling.
Conclusion
57
From the assessment in the preceding paragraphs, it would appear that the measures introduced since 1973 have generally achieved their objectives. However, as the illegal gambling scene is always in a somewhat fluid situation, as evidenced by the apparent increase in mobile casino establishments in 1978, it is intended that periodic reviews be conducted of the overall situation.
Public Relations Aspect
58
As gambling is à highly emotive subject, special attention has been paid to public reaction monitored over the past year in the review. It is considered that the public, many of whom have been sceptical about Government's policy of providing a legal substitute to combat illegal gamblig, would probably feel relieved to learn of the substantial reduction in the overall level of illegal gambling activities. To the more conservative sector, the proposals to-- restrain further expansion of off-course betting centres and exotic bets and the continued prohibition of casino gambling and off-course betting on Macao greyhound racing are likely to be welcomed as firm steps taken by Government to draw the line and curb any further spread of the gambling habit. The emphasis on discouraging young people from taking up the gambling habit through stipulating a minimum age for entry into race courses and off-course betting centres is also likely to be regarded as a move in the right direction.
Publicity
59.
As the conclusion of this review represents little departure from the existing policy, and as gambling is such a controversial topic, it is intended that no specific effort should be made to publish the outcome of this review. However, as the subject is likely to remain one of constant interest to the public, the information contained in this paper will be used to answer queries from the media as and when the need arises;
